Swiftships Shipbuilders, LLC, Morgan City, La., is being awarded a $20,221,529 modification to previously awarded contract (N00024-09-C-2210) for the detail, design and construction of four 28-meter coastal patrol crafts (CPCs) and associated crew familiarization training and technical services for the Egyptian Navy under the Foreign Military Sales Program

More than 80 major exhibitors have confirmed their attendance at the inaugural NAVDEX (Naval Defence Exhibition), which will be held in parallel with IDEX, the region’s leading defence and security show, at the Abu Dhabi National Exhibition Centre from 20th – 24th February 2011, under the patronage of of His Highness Sheikh Khalifa Bin Zayed Al Nahyan, President of the UAE. Visitors to NAVDEX can expect to see the latest in naval defence technology with exhibits of warships, naval workboats and amphibious crafts, combat equipment, coastal security systems and sea-to-shore communication solutions

General Atomics (GA) and General Atomics Systems Integration, LLC (GA-SI) have been awarded a one-year task order by the United States Air Force (USAF) under the F-16 Drag Brace Down Lock Redesign Program to complete the full Main Landing Gear assembly fatigue tests and drop tests to verify that the assembly, including the drag brace down lock, maintains fatigue life integrity with the increased hydraulic force of a redesigned push-pull actuator. The contract task order was issued by 417 Supply Chain Management Squadron (SCMS) at Hill Air Force Base (AFB)
The Defense Advanced Research Projects Agency (DARPA), committed to revolutionizing defense manufacturing through its Adaptive Vehicle Make (AVM) initiative, has awarded 13 performer contracts for the META program. META is one part of the AVM portfolio and aimed at model-based design and verification of complex systems that are correct-by-construction
